This allows users to swap point and mark to jump between use and definition in the same buffer, or pop-tag-mark (M-*) to jump back to the use even between multiple buffers. This mirrors the behaviour of godef-jump from go-mode. Also remove an obosolete TODO and fix a typo. README
This subrepository holds the source for various packages and tools that support the Go programming language. Some of the tools, godoc and vet for example, are included in binary Go distributions. Others, including the Go oracle and the test coverage tool, can be fetched with "go get". Packages include a type-checker for Go and an implementation of the Static Single Assignment form (SSA) representation for Go programs. To submit changes to this repository, see http://golang.org/doc/contribute.html.
